  • Abstract
    A 24 GHz LO signal is generated indirectly by proposing a 12 GHz VCO followed by an active mixer which acts as a frequency doubler. This technique improves the tunability and reduces the power consumption of the VCO/Active doubler compared to a stand-alone VCO at 24 GHz considerably while providing the same amount of phase noise. The circuit is implemented in 0.18 mum CMOS technology. The resulted indirect VCO has 20% tuning range, 15 mW power consumption, -8.5 dBm output power and a phase noise around -100 dBc/Hz @ 1 MHz offset for a 23.5 GHz carrier. This VCO is suitable for use in low power 24 GHz PLLs and also direct conversion receiver applications.
